In 2008, Sophia Balestri contacted Luc Le Clech (Bluff, Picnic, Somber Heroes) and Eric Saussine to create a teaser trailer for her upcoming French-language novel La Plume et l’Envol (Feather And Flight). Eric Saussine was interested by the concept and accepted with the gracious condition that he could use the footage to make a short film of his own.
As a matter of fact the two videos use some 80% common footage. Moreover the short film does not have the literary voice over of the Teaser Trailer. The footage left alone forms a sylvan and contemplative yet coherent narrative about a girl looking for some personal life that society prohibits. The two videos’ color-grading is also totally different, La Plume et l’envol (2008) bearing autumnal colors and Nocturne (2011)... night colors.
When the leading female character walks along a lake, this short films present a couple of shots that Peter Jackson would have deemed acceptable for his famous adaptations of The Lord Of The Rings.
